Description

The Truetone 1 SPOT Pro CS6 power supply is the first low-profile power brick to use switching power supply technology. With its compact form factor, the CS6 is designed to fit under pedalboards like the Pedaltrain Nano and Metro series. However, you can also mount it on top of a pedalboard and use it as a pedal riser, mounting pedals on top of the CS6. Each of the six outputs are completely isolated, regulated and filtered to give you noise-free performance. With no transformer to hinder its abilities, there is never any proximity noise. And being part of the 1 SPOT family, it will work anywhere in the world without modification.

Specs

The CS6 has the following outputs:
  • Output 1-2: 9VDC (500mA)
  • Outputs 3-4: 9VDC or 18VDC (100mA each)
  • Outputs 5-6: 9VDC or 12VDC (200mA each)
  • In addition to the international IEC input cable, the 1 SPOT Pro CS6 comes with the following:
Power cables (all are center pin negative polarity)
  • (4) DC18 (5.5 x 2.1 mm barrel plugs; 18” (457 mm) – White
  • (3) DC12 (5.5 x 2.1 mm barrel plugs; 12” (305 mm) – Yellow
  • (1) DC26 (5.5 x 2.1 mm barrel plugs; 26” (660 mm) – Purple
  • (1) DC22 (5.5 x 2.1 mm barrel plugs; 22” (559 mm) – Blue
  • (1) DC18 (5.5 x 2.1 mm barrel plugs; 18” (457 mm) – White
  • (3) DC12 (5.5 x 2.1 mm barrel plugs; 12” (305 mm) – Yellow
  • (1) MC2: Two 5.5 x 2.1 mm barrel plugs with 5.5 x 2.1 mm input socket
Converter Plugs:
  • (1) CL6 – (5.5 x 2.1 mm barrel input, 5.5 x 2.5 mm barrel output; reverse polarity)
  • Green – for Line 6 DL4/M9/etc. and some Eventide pedals.
  • (1) CYR – (5.5 x 2.1 mm barrel input, 5.5 x 2.1 mm barrel output; reverse polarity)
  • Red – reverse polarity converter
  • (1) C35 – (5.5 x 2.1 mm barrel input, 3.5 mm male output; tip positive)
  • Black – 3.5 mm (1/8”) plug converter
  • (1) CBAT – (5.5 x 2.1 mm barrel input, black battery clip output)
  • Connects to battery clip wires inside pedals that do not have DC jacks (Do NOT connect to a battery).
Dimensions:
  • 6.3” x 3.46” x 1.22” (160 x 88 x 31 mm); 1.30 lb. (590 grams); weight and dimensions of power supply only, not including cables or packaging
